Originally Posted by katmu
Ours locally has the commuter convoys, reception area downtown with free breakfast, prizes for participants who register, help with finding routes prior to the ride day, maps, information about bike lockers and showers. the local transit company is a partner as they encourage people who can't ride the whole distance to bike part way and then use the on-bus bike racks.
All both of them...pet peeve of mine...the buses around here only have capacity for 2 bikes. If you catch the wrong bus or stop, the racks are full. I have noticed more than one bike chained to the bus stop bench or a nearby sign post.
